Barddhaman Travel Guide: Things to Do, How to Reach, Best Time to Visit
Barddhaman, also known as Burdwan, is a significant city in West Bengal. It serves as an administrative, industrial, and educational hub. The city is famous for its unique sweets, Mihidana and Sitabhog, which hold GI tags.

Ranaghat Travel Guide: Things to Do, How to Reach, Best Time to Visit
Ranaghat is a bustling railway junction town in West Bengal's Nadia district. It serves as a commercial and agricultural hub for the surrounding areas. You will find a glimpse into authentic Bengali small-town life here, away from major tourist crowds.

Where to Eat in Sukta: Local Cuisine Guide
Must-Try Dishes in Sukta
Don't leave Sukta without tasting these local specialties:
- Macher Jhol - Traditional Bengali fish curry, usually with Rohu or Katla fish, served with rice. Available at local eateries, rupees 150-250.
- Shukto - A bitter-sweet mixed vegetable curry, a classic Bengali starter. Found in traditional Bengali restaurants, rupees 100-180.
- Luchi and Alur Dom - Deep-fried flatbread (luchi) served with a spicy potato curry (alur dom). Popular breakfast or snack, local stalls, rupees 50-100.
- Mishti Doi - Sweetened thick yogurt, a Bengali dessert staple. Available at sweet shops, rupees 40-80 per cup.
- Chhanar Jilipi - A jalebi-like sweet made from cottage cheese, deep-fried and soaked in sugar syrup. Sweet shops in Berhampore, rupees 20-40 per piece.
- Shor Bhaja - A unique sweet made from layers of milk cream, deep-fried and soaked in syrup. Specific sweet shops in Murshidabad, rupees 50-100 per piece.

Sukta Travel Tips: Money, Safety & Local Advice
💰 Money & Budget
🏥 Health & Safety
📱 Communication
👕 What to Wear
Dress modestly, especially when visiting temples or rural areas. Lightweight cotton clothing is best for the climate. For women, salwar kameez or long skirts are appropriate. For men, trousers and shirts. Carry a light shawl or scarf for sun protection and temple visits.
